Long-time EuroLeague fan, got frustrated with how limited existing stat platforms are for European basketball specifically.

So I built my own tool, EuroPropsLab is a web application for analyzing EuroLeague basketball players. It displays historical stats, hit rates, and trends across key categories (points, rebounds, assists, PIR) to help users evaluate player props betting lines. The app includes live game tracking, injured players, and personalized favorites, with full user authentication and accounts. The frontend is a React/Vite SPA, the backend is Node.js/Express with PostgreSQL, deployed on Vercel.
